Monthly Visual Inspection: The Quick Scan

A comprehensive maintenance plan starts with a simple monthly walk-through. This 5-minute check ensures that nothing physical is hindering emergency response:

  • Accessibility: Is the hydrant obstructed by overgrown landscaping, fences, or parked vehicles?
  • Visual Damage: Are there any obvious cracks in the cast iron or missing outlet caps?
  • Signage: Are the reflective markers and identification numbers clearly visible?

The Essential Annual Maintenance Checklist

Once a year, a more technical “hands-on” inspection is required. Follow these steps to ensure internal mechanical integrity:

1. Lubricating the Operating Nut and Threads

A seized hydrant is a useless hydrant. Remove the weather cap and apply a food-grade, water-resistant lubricant to the operating nut. Also, clean and lubricate the nozzle threads to ensure fire hoses can be connected without cross-threading or sticking.

2. Inspecting Caps and Gaskets

Inspect the rubber gaskets inside the outlet caps. Cracked or dry-rotted gaskets lead to significant pressure loss during operation. If you find damage, replace them immediately with high-quality fire hydrant parts.

3. Verifying the Automatic Drain Mechanism

For dry barrel fire hydrants, the drain system is critical. After a test, the water remaining in the barrel must drain out within minutes. If it doesn’t, the water will freeze in winter, cracking the hydrant body.

Executing a Full Flow and Pressure Test

Beyond mechanical checks, you must verify the water supply. A flow test helps identify internal pipe scaling or closed valves upstream.

  • Static Pressure: Measure the pressure when water is not flowing.
  • Residual Pressure: Measure the pressure while at least one outlet is fully open.
  • Flushing: Let the water run until it is clear. This removes sediment that could otherwise clog your fire sprinkler heads if the system is ever activated.

FAQ

Can I use standard motor oil for hydrant lubrication? No. Petroleum-based oils can degrade rubber seals. Always use the manufacturer-recommended silicone or food-grade grease.

What should I do if a hydrant is leaking from the base? This usually indicates a failure in the main valve seat or the drain valve. You should contact a professional to replace the internal seals using a hydrant repair kit.
